Calico Aster
Scientific Name: Aster lateriflorus
Family: Asteraceae
Description: Several small flower heads of white or pale purple ray flowers surrounding yellow or purple disk flowers are on one side of straggly, divergent branches
Habitat: Fields, thickets
Range: Eastern North America west to Tennessee and Arkansas
Comments: One of a group of closely related and difficult to distinguish Asters.
